Nigerian singer Fireboy DML has announced that he is working on a joint Extended Play (EP) with fellow artist Lojay.
In an interview with The Beat 99.9 FM, Lagos, Fireboy revealed that the collaboration is underway, citing a strong creative relationship with Lojay in the studio.
This news follows the release of Fireboy’s fourth studio album, “Adedamola,” which featured a collaboration with Lagbaja on the song “Back N Forth.”
Fireboy praised Lagbaja’s meticulous approach to artistry and shared his learning experience from their time together in the studio.
The upcoming EP with Lojay promises to deliver soulful vocals, groovy beats, and heartfelt lyrics exploring themes of love, passion, and self-discovery.
